HAPPY INTERNATIONAL MEN’S DAY- ( Redefining Strength: Encouraging the Future of Boys and Men)
<p>For generations, boys and men have been taught that strength is measured by silence, control, and the ability to endure hardship without complaint. But a new era is rising—one where strength is defined more broadly, more compassionately, and more truthfully.<br/></p><p>On International Men’s Day, we champion boys and men not just for what they do but for who they are—human beings with emotions, hopes, insecurities, creativity, and dreams.</p><p>Encouraging boys and men means giving them permission to grow beyond outdated expectations. It means celebrating their leadership as much as their laughter, their courage as much as their questions. It means supporting fathers who balance tenderness with discipline, young men searching for identity, and boys discovering what kind of humans they want to become.</p><p>When we uplift men, we uplift families. When we provide boys with mentorship, emotional literacy, and purpose, we empower the next generation to build stronger societies.</p><p>This year, let us commit to supporting the mental, emotional, and physical well-being of every boy and man. Let us applaud healthy masculinity—responsibility, empathy, resilience, and respect. And let us champion the idea that becoming a “strong man” has far less to do with being tough, and far more to do with being true.</p><p><br/></p><p><a class="tc-blue" href="https://twocents.space/insights/tag/noble">#noble</a> <a class="tc-blue" href="https://twocents.space/insights/tag/completeness">#completeness</a></p>
